> Mary Arginteanu, Larry Robinson, John Dillard and I opened the nets at the
> Powhatan Wildlife Management Area twice in September after completing this
> season's Monitoring Avian Productivity and Survivorship sessions on August
> 3rd. A total of 60 birds were captured on those two fine mornings: 54
newly
> banded and 6 recaptures. The list of birds is as follows:
